Pyrite Sand Dollar - Mineral 🌎 10-Week Course TopicsPyrite Sand Dollar Mineral Size: 2" About Pyrite Sand Dollars: Pyrite Sand Dollars are rare and fascinating mineral fossils formed when ancient sand dollars were preserved and replaced by pyrite (iron sulfide), often called fools gold, most famously from coal regions in Illinois, USA.
